Understanding Color Blindness: A Comprehensive Guide

Photo Color Blindness

Color blindness, also known as color vision deficiency, is a visual impairment that affects an individual’s ability to perceive colors accurately. Contrary to the common misconception that color blindness means seeing in black and white, most individuals with this condition can see colors but may struggle to distinguish between certain hues. The condition arises from anomalies in the photoreceptors of the retina, specifically the cones responsible for color detection.

These cones are sensitive to different wavelengths of light, and when they do not function correctly, it can lead to a skewed perception of colors. The prevalence of color blindness varies across populations, with estimates suggesting that approximately 8% of men and 0.5% of women of Northern European descent are affected. This disparity is largely due to genetic factors, as color blindness is often inherited in an X-linked recessive pattern.

While color blindness is typically a lifelong condition, it can also be acquired due to certain medical conditions or exposure to specific chemicals. Understanding color blindness is crucial for fostering awareness and support for those affected by this visual impairment.

Types of Color Blindness

Color blindness is not a singular condition but rather encompasses several types, each characterized by distinct patterns of color perception. The most common form is red-green color blindness, which can be further divided into two categories: protanopia and deuteranopia. Protanopia occurs when the red cones are absent or non-functional, leading to difficulty in distinguishing between reds and greens.

Deuteranopia, on the other hand, involves the absence or malfunctioning of green cones, resulting in similar challenges with red and green hues. Another type of color blindness is tritanopia, which affects blue-yellow perception. Individuals with tritanopia have difficulty distinguishing between blues and greens, as well as yellows and violets.

This form of color blindness is much rarer than red-green deficiencies. Additionally, there are cases of monochromacy, where individuals have only one type of cone functioning or none at all, leading to a limited perception of colors. Each type of color blindness presents unique challenges and requires tailored approaches for diagnosis and management.

Causes of Color Blindness

The primary cause of color blindness is genetic inheritance, particularly through mutations on the X chromosome. Since males have only one X chromosome, they are more likely to express color blindness if they inherit a defective gene from their mother. In contrast, females have two X chromosomes, which provides a backup if one is affected.

However, females can still be carriers and may express mild forms of color vision deficiency. In addition to genetic factors, color blindness can also be acquired through various medical conditions or environmental influences. For instance, certain eye diseases such as cataracts or glaucoma can impair color perception by affecting the retina or optic nerve.

Furthermore, exposure to toxic substances or chemicals can damage the photoreceptors in the eyes, leading to acquired color vision deficiencies. Understanding these causes is essential for developing effective strategies for diagnosis and management.

Signs and Symptoms of Color Blindness

Individuals with color blindness may not always be aware of their condition, especially if they have learned to adapt their perception over time. However, there are common signs and symptoms that can indicate a color vision deficiency. One of the most prevalent indicators is difficulty distinguishing between specific colors, particularly reds and greens or blues and yellows.

This can manifest in various situations, such as misidentifying traffic lights or struggling to interpret color-coded information. In addition to challenges with color differentiation, individuals with color blindness may experience frustration or confusion when engaging in activities that rely heavily on color recognition. For example, they may find it challenging to choose clothing that matches or to interpret art and design elements accurately.

While these symptoms may seem minor, they can significantly impact an individual’s confidence and self-esteem in social situations.

Diagnosing Color Blindness

Diagnosing color blindness typically involves a comprehensive eye examination conducted by an optometrist or ophthalmologist. The process often begins with a visual acuity test to assess overall vision health before moving on to specialized tests designed to evaluate color perception. One of the most commonly used tests is the Ishihara test, which consists of a series of plates containing colored dots arranged in patterns that form numbers or shapes visible only to individuals with normal color vision.

Other diagnostic tools include the Farnsworth-Munsell 100 Hue Test and the Anomaloscope, which provide more detailed assessments of an individual’s color discrimination abilities. These tests help determine the type and severity of color blindness present. Once diagnosed, individuals can better understand their condition and explore potential coping strategies or accommodations that may enhance their daily lives.

Living with Color Blindness

Living with color blindness can present unique challenges, but many individuals find ways to adapt and thrive despite their visual limitations. Awareness and education about the condition are crucial for fostering understanding among friends, family members, and colleagues. By openly discussing their experiences with color vision deficiency, individuals can help others appreciate their perspective and encourage supportive environments.

In addition to fostering understanding, individuals with color blindness often develop practical strategies for navigating daily life. For instance, they may rely on labels or organizational systems that utilize shapes or patterns instead of colors to differentiate items. Technology has also played a significant role in enhancing accessibility for those with color vision deficiencies; smartphone applications that identify colors or provide descriptions can be invaluable tools for everyday tasks.

How Color Blindness Affects Daily Life

The impact of color blindness on daily life can vary significantly from person to person, depending on the severity of the condition and individual coping mechanisms. In professional settings, individuals may encounter challenges when interpreting graphs or charts that rely heavily on color coding. This can lead to misunderstandings or miscommunications if colleagues are unaware of their visual limitations.

Social situations can also be affected by color blindness; for example, individuals may struggle to choose clothing that matches or may feel self-conscious about their inability to perceive colors accurately during group activities involving art or design. However, many individuals with color blindness develop resilience and creativity in finding alternative ways to engage with their environment while minimizing potential frustrations.

Treatment and Management of Color Blindness

Currently, there is no cure for genetic forms of color blindness; however, various management strategies can help individuals navigate their daily lives more effectively. One approach involves utilizing assistive technologies designed specifically for those with color vision deficiencies. These tools can range from smartphone applications that identify colors to specialized glasses that enhance contrast between certain hues.

Education plays a vital role in managing color blindness as well; individuals can benefit from learning about their specific type of deficiency and understanding how it affects their perception of colors. This knowledge empowers them to advocate for themselves in various settings—whether at work or in social situations—ensuring that others are aware of their needs and limitations.

Coping Strategies for Color Blindness

Coping strategies for individuals with color blindness often involve practical adaptations that enhance their ability to navigate daily life successfully. One effective strategy is developing a keen awareness of context; for instance, understanding that certain colors are associated with specific meanings (e.g., red for stop) can help individuals make informed decisions even when they cannot perceive colors accurately. Additionally, individuals may benefit from creating systems that rely on non-color cues—such as shapes or patterns—to differentiate items in their environment.

For example, organizing clothing by style rather than color can simplify wardrobe choices while minimizing frustration. Engaging in open conversations about their experiences with friends and family can also foster understanding and support within social circles.

Color Blindness in Children

Color blindness often becomes apparent during childhood when children begin learning about colors in school settings. Parents may notice signs such as difficulty identifying colors in books or struggles with art projects that require accurate color recognition. Early diagnosis is essential for providing appropriate support and accommodations as children navigate their educational experiences.

Schools play a crucial role in supporting children with color blindness by implementing inclusive teaching practices that consider diverse learning needs. Educators can utilize alternative methods for teaching colors—such as incorporating tactile experiences or using descriptive language—to ensure that all students have equal opportunities for engagement and learning.
